gpt4 book ai didi

mysql配置变量: where in the world is my. ini?

转载 作者:行者123 更新时间:2023-11-29 02:28:05 26 4
gpt4 key购买 nike

我正在尝试更改其中一个 mysql 变量。

[mysqld]
ft_min_word_len=2

在外部服务器上,我可以在 my.cnf 中更改它。但是,我终其一生都无法在计算机上找到此文件。我也找不到 my.ini(我在 Windows 上)。我可以找到 my-huge.ini 和其他各种尺寸。

问题

  • 可以叫别的名字吗?
  • 我必须成功吗?或者,是否可以在不打开文件的情况下更改此选项?

因为 ft_min_word_len 已经有一个值,所以它一定在某个地方!

我试过了

mysqld --help

但它并没有真正告诉我任何事情。我试过:

mysqld --help --verbose

它说了很多,无论开头是什么,我都看不到。它不会让我打印到任何文件:“访问被拒绝”

编辑:我用

寻找它

目录/s my.ini

最佳答案

我有一个小惊喜要送给你。你说你找到了my-huge.ini . my-huge.ini 所在的文件夹驻留在文件夹my.ini应该是。如果my.ini不在同一文件夹中,THEN my.ini根本不存在。因此,mysqld.exe在所有配置设置的纯默认值上运行。

每当 MySQL 作为服务安装时,都没有 my.ini创建。多年来,我注意到在 MSI 安装 MySQL 后,文件 mysqld.exe (在 bin 文件夹中)查找 my.ini 的父目录.

假设您找到了 my-huge.inic:/wamp/bin/mysql/mysqlVERSIONNUMBER

只需创建 my.ini也在那个地方。然后,重新启动 mysql服务。使用 Run as Administrator 打开 DOS 窗口并运行以下命令:

C:\> cd c:\wamp\bin\mysql\mysqlVERSIONNUMBER
C:\> echo "[mysqld]" > my.ini
C:\> echo "ft_min_word_len=2" >> my.ini
C:\> net stop mysql
C:\> net start mysql

试一试!!!

关于mysql配置变量: where in the world is my. ini?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/17885522/

26 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com